AISENSON, Diana; POLASTRI, Graciela y VIRGILI, Natalia. Subjective transformations of young people in the transition from school to higher education and/or work. Anu. investig. [online]. 2014, vol.21, n.1, pp.55-63. ISSN 1851-1686.
In this study the subjective processes and transformations are analyzed in youth who are inishing secondary school. Depth interviews were conducted with youth in the school context, focusing the subjective processes that are mobilized, on three psycho-social areas : a)Family, b)Study, Work and Leisure and c) Friends, Couple and Significant others. The content analysis of the interviews allows the observation of the dynamic interactions that exist between these areas and the recognition of young people for the changes in growth and identity transformations and the future intentions of starting projects. The interview was experienced by young people as an opportunity to conduct an analysis of their current situation and their life projects. In this sense, the results of this study are a contribution to the Psychology of Orientation.
